## Authentication

Heads up: the nightly reindex job (`reindex_nightly.py`) talks to the Lanternfish search cluster, and that cluster won't accept anonymous writes anymore — we locked it down last sprint. The job now authenticates as the `reindex-runner` service identity against Corvid Gateway, and the token is injected via the `LF_INDEX_TOKEN` env var in the scheduler config. Nothing clever going on, just a bearer header on every batch request. For review purposes, the staging credential currently in use is listed below.

service key, kadug-kadup: kto15_rN23XLAYImmZgrJ

## Formula sandbox tuning

User-supplied formulas in Gridmoor execute inside a restricted interpreter with hard ceilings on time, memory, and call depth. Reviewers should confirm any change to these ceilings is justified in the PR description, since raising them widens the abuse surface. Defaults were chosen from production traces. The current limits are as follows.

limits module of tafog-fawip:
WEIGHTS = {
    "julix": 57,
    "lamys": 992,
    "kasvan": 209,
    "quenok": 750,
    "alddor": 259,
    "oliath": 1009,
    "wenix": 815,
}

## Data stores behind KnowlBurrow permissions

Role checks in our wiki aren't magic — every page view hits the roles table first, then the page ACL cache. If permissions look wrong, the cache is almost always the culprit; flush it before blaming the data. The roles database lives here:

replica DSN, kajep-yahag: mssql://praok_svc:iF@db-8d68.plorvaio.local:5432/eliion

14:22 — Offline sync regression confirmed (Terrapath field-survey app)

At 14:22 the on-call engineer reproduced the data-loss path: surveys saved while offline were marked synced once connectivity returned, even when the upload was rejected. The queue flush skipped the server acknowledgement check introduced in the previous sprint. Release manager note: the fix must ship before the coastal survey season. The offending build is identified by the token recorded below.

session token of kawif-fawig = htk31_f3f599be2b1a34affb1efa8d0feccf8